Quick Chicken and Corn Chowder



CookBook Recepie image


Prep Time:
15 mins

Cook Time:
25 mins

Total Time:
40 mins

Servings:
6

Yield:
6 servings


Ingredients

  • 1tablespoonolive oil
  • 8ouncesskinless, boneless chicken breast halves, cut into bite-size pieces
  • ½cupchopped onion
  • ½cupchopped red bell pepper
  • 1clovegarlic, minced
  • 4cupslow-sodium chicken broth
  • 1 ½cupsfrozen corn
  • 1cupskim milk
  • 1tablespooncornstarch, or more as needed
  • 1cupwhite be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1cupshredded Cheddar cheese
  • ½teaspoonsalt (Optional)
  • ¼teaspoonground black pepper

  • Directions

    Heat olive oil in a saucepan over medium heat; saute chicken, onion, red bell pepper, and garlic until chicken is no longer pink in the center and onion is tender, 3 to 5 minutes. Add chicken broth and corn to chicken mixture.

    Whisk milk and cornstarch together in a bowl until dissolved; stir into soup. Bring soup to a boil, reduce heat, and simmer until thickened, about 15 minutes. Stir white beans, Cheddar cheese, salt, and pepper into soup; simmer until cheese is melted, about 5 minutes.
